At 6:30 p.m., immediately preceding Call to Order, the Village Board of Trustees will hold a public comment period, for the purpose of allowing the non-elected general public the opportunity to address the Board on any subject of concern that is not the topic of a current or previous Public Hearing before the Village Board. Each person who wishes to address the Village Board of Trustees may do so at the podium for a maximum of 3 minutes. The Board will only receive comments during Public Comment. The Public Comment portion of the meeting is scheduled for a total of 15 minutes in length but will end sooner if the Village President has determined that there is no one else present who still wishes to speak. After Public Comment has ended, there will be a short recess to begin broadcast of the Board of Trustees Meeting.

7.   Plan Commission - Discussion and possible action on the following items:
 
a.   The request of AT&T Mobility to obtain a Conditional Use Permit allowing a wireless communications facility on the property owned by Brook Falls Ventures, LLC located at N48W14850 Lisbon Road.  At its meeting on March 4, 2014 the Plan Commission unanimously recommended this Permit be approved subject to 15 conditions.  At its meeting on March 25, 2014 the Architectural Control Board unanimously recommended the Permit be approved subject to 4 conditions. Click to View
 
b.   The request of the Village of Menomonee Falls to obtain a Conditional Use Permit for the construction and operation of a new Fire Station located on the Southwest Corner of Main Street and Menomonee Avenue.  At its meeting on March 4, 2014 the Plan Commission unanimously recommended this Permit be approved subject to 15 conditions of approval and 5 conditions running with the Permit.  At its meeting on March 25, 2014 the Architectural Control Board unanimously recommended this Permit be approved subject to 2 conditions. Click to View
 
c.   The request of the Village of Menomonee Falls to obtain a Conditional Use Permit allowing the construction and operation of Fire Station No. 5 located at N56W19350 Silver Spring Drive.  At its meeting on March 4, 2014 the Plan Commission unanimously recommended this Permit be approved subject to 16 conditions of approval and 5 conditions running with the Permit.  At its meeting on March 25, 2014 the Architectural Control Board unanimously recommended this permit be approved subject to 2 conditions.
